Greek Sesame Bread Rings (Koulouri Thessalonikis)

Bushra
Traditional Greek sesame-coated bread rings with a crispy exterior and soft interior
Prep Time 1 hour 30 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 45 minutes
Course Breads
Cuisine Greek, Mediterranean
Servings 12 pieces
Calories 281 kcal

Equipment

  • Stand mixer
  • baking trays
  • Parchment Paper

Ingredients
  

For the dough

  • 500 g all purpose flour (19 oz.)
  • 2 tsp salt
  • 300 g lukewarm water (10.5 oz.)
  • 8 g dry active yeast (0.3 oz.)
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• 3 tbsp olive oil

To garnish

  • 200-250 g sesame seeds (8-9 oz.)
  • water for dipping

Instructions
 

  • In the mixer's bowl add the lukewarm water, the yeast and sugar and stir. Wrap well with plastic wrap and set aside for about 8-10 minutes, until the yeast starts bubbling.
  • Into the same bowl, add first the flour, then the salt and olive oil. Using the dough hook, mix all the ingredients at low speed for about 7 minutes, until the dough becomes an elastic ball.
  • When done, remove the dough from the hook and check out its texture. It should be smooth and elastic and slightly sticky. If it is too sticky, add just a little more flour (1/2 tsp), mix and check again.
  • Coat lightly a bowl with some olive oil, place the dough inside and cover with plastic wrap. Let the dough sit in warm place for about 30 minutes. Knead the dough again at medium-high speed for 3-4 minutes.
  • Turn the dough onto a working surface and divide into 12 pieces. Take one piece of the dough and roll out into a rope approx. 35cm long. Form a circle and join the ends pinching them together.
  • Place the bread ring on a large baking tray, lined up with parchment paper and repeat with the rest of the dough. (You will need two large baking trays.)
  • Prepare the ingredients for the garnish. In one bowl pour some water. In a separate bowl or tray place the sesame seeds. Dip the koulouria (bread rings) in water and then in sesame seeds, making sure to cover them on all sides.
  • Place them back on your baking sheets, leaving some distance between them. Let them rise in a warm place for about 30 minutes.
  • Bake in preheated oven at 200C for about 15 minutes, until nicely golden brown and crusty.
